Frederic Prokosch
0 sources
Frederic Prokosch
Summary
Frederic Prokosch is a human[1]. Born in Madison[2], he… he was born on May 17, 1908[3]. He passed away in Grasse[4]. He died on June 6, 1989[5]. He worked as a linguist[6], poet[7], racquetball player[8], translator[9], and novelist[10].
